"Notwithstanding the foregoing" simply means "despite what was just said." In other words, it's a way of introducing an exception.

Therefore, "Notwithstanding the foregoing" in the sentence is just a … truthicaWebMar 27, 2024 · The word “notwithstanding” means in spite of or despite. The word “foregoing” means what has come earlier.
